6.9 Adjusting Twenty-Seven or Thirty Speed
Cassette Chain
1.
Loosen, but do not remove the clamp that secure the crank
handles to the fork.
2.
Slide the crank handles up and/or down until the proper tension
on the chain is achieved.
The proper chain tension will be approximately 1/2-inch
(1.27 cm) of chain slack.
If crank is in desired position but chain tension is not
correct, links MUST be added to or removed from the
chain to correct the tension. This should be performed
by a qualified technician.
3.
Tighten the clamp that secures the crank handles to the fork
securely.

6.11 Installing V/S Crankarm Handles

WARNING!
– After any adjustments, repair or service and before
use, make sure all attaching hardware is tightened
securely. Otherwise injury or damage may occur.
– Failure to install handle assembly properly could result
in injury.
– It is recommended to inspect this assembly prior to
and after each use.
Screw handle A into crankarm housing B (right handle has
right-handed thread; left handle has left-handed thread).
Handle should spin freely with minimal play. If handle does
not spin freely, contact Top End Customer Service at the
phone number on the back cover of this manual.
